Removed default capacity of DynamicJsonDocument

This commit is contained in:
Benoit Blanchon
2019-01-14 10:32:19 +01:00
parent f0784d3b41
commit 9ac2ac303c
73 changed files with 163 additions and 155 deletions

View File

@ -7,22 +7,22 @@
template <typename T, typename U>
static void check(const char* input, U expected) {
DynamicJsonDocument variant;
DynamicJsonDocument doc(4096);
DeserializationError error = deserializeMsgPack(variant, input);
DeserializationError error = deserializeMsgPack(doc, input);
REQUIRE(error == DeserializationError::Ok);
REQUIRE(variant.is<T>());
REQUIRE(variant.as<T>() == expected);
REQUIRE(doc.is<T>());
REQUIRE(doc.as<T>() == expected);
}
static void checkIsNull(const char* input) {
DynamicJsonDocument variant;
DynamicJsonDocument doc(4096);
DeserializationError error = deserializeMsgPack(variant, input);
DeserializationError error = deserializeMsgPack(doc, input);
REQUIRE(error == DeserializationError::Ok);
REQUIRE(variant.as<JsonVariant>().isNull());
REQUIRE(doc.as<JsonVariant>().isNull());
}
TEST_CASE("deserialize MsgPack value") {